Default Connecting to the Internet through another PC

Hi,

Does anyone know how easy it is to connect to the internet using another PC please?

Basically, I'll have a NTL cable modem connected to my PC. What I want to do is connect a wireless network card to this, and then connect to this PC on a laptop, using a wireless network card on a laptop. So the laptop can access the internet connection that the PC has.

I know people may probably suggest a wireless router instead for this, but that isn't an option as I only want to do this for a week, so dont want to buy a wireless router.

Does anyone know how easy this would be please? Both on XP by the way.

Cheers

Steve

Actually. Thinking about this with a clearer head. you will need the following:

2 x rj-45 network cables
1 x switching hub

Both PC's need network cards.

Connect you're NTL network cable into the switching hub. Then connect both pc's up to the hub via there network cards and the 2x rj-45 cables. Set-up the 2nd PC the same as the first. Then you can both surf without keeping a PC on to do it.
